US President Joe Biden made an unscheduled statement about the events of the recent downing of unidentified planes. It has been reported DEA News.

As the head of state stated, there is nothing to suggest that the objects shot down in the northern United States and Canada were related to any state’s intelligence programs.

Also, according to Biden, the three flying objects dropped by the US last week were apparently balloons of private companies or research institutes.

“We don’t know yet what exactly these three objects are, but nothing, nothing now indicates that they are related to China’s program of spy balloons or reconnaissance vehicles,” the American president said.

Biden also added that if the “object” poses a threat to the United States, then the president will order him shot.

On February 5, the US military shot down a Chinese balloon that had been hovering over US soil for several days. The Pentagon called the downed device a spy device, while China said the balloon was a civilian probe and ended up accidentally over the United States. american side refused The wreckage of a dropped balloon returns to China.

After Xie Feng, Chinese Deputy Foreign Minister declarationHe said that the actions of the United States regarding the balloon hurt the process of stabilizing relations between the two countries.
